Drift Suction Cup Mount

I'm thinking of getting one for my Drift HD for alternate camera angles. Anybody with one have any thoughts? Does it work and hold well? Do you trust it? Should I get some secondary way of securing it? I don't really want to put the little adhesive camera mounts on various places on my bike, but would if I needed to.

The Drift suction mount is nothing but a rebranded version of:
Panavise Camera Mount
Delkin Camera Mount

I have both kinds, and they work great. Held with no problem hitting 145 mph. Just make sure you put it on a nonflexible part of the bike. Otherwise, vibration will make the image look horrible.

Side fairings, swingarm, windshield, and tank, are those okay to put it on?

Yes, those areas are fine. But, you will find the best spots in those areas to place the mount. For example, the top of the windscreen has too much vibration for me. But the middle to the bottom have no issues. Trial and error...
